Replacing all azdata with az (#16502)

* Changed azdata to az in azcli extension and resource-deployment, and some arc. Removed user, pass, url from controller connect blade. Commented out tests. Ported over work from old branch.

* Changed unit tests, all unit tests passing. Changed parameters to new ones, fixed some Controller Connect issues.

* Connect data controller and create dc working.

* Changed az back to azdata in necessary places in resource-deployment.

* Changed notebook values and added namespace to some params.

* Added some changes from PR to this branch

* Changed azdata.ts to az.ts and changed subscription parameter

* Brought over changes from azcli PR into this branch.

* added endpoint, username, password to getIsPassword

* Changed notebooks to use proper az params, hard coded in some values to verify it is working, removed some variableNames from package.json.

* Changed -sc to --storage-class in notebook

* Added namespace to SQL deploy, deleted dc create in api

* Deleted more dc create code and uncommented findAz() with unfinished work on Do Not Ask Again.

* Removed (preview) from extensions/arc and extensions/azcli excluding preview:true in package.json

* Commented out install/update prompts until DoNotAskAgain is implemented

* Fixed bugs: JSON Output errors are now being caught, --infrastructure now has a required UI component with dropdown options, config page loads properly, SQL create flags use full names instead of shortnames.
